Embark on a meaningful contract opportunity supporting foundational learning for early childhood to 6th-grade students for the 2026-2027 school year. This hands-on role focuses on life skills instruction within a small classroom setting, working closely with a total of five students—two of whom require more extensive functional support.

You’ll play a key role in a collaborative environment, actively participating in Admission, Review, and Dismissal (ARD) meetings, and ensuring the educational success of each student while adhering to the district’s community-oriented dress and conduct policies.

Key Qualifications:

  • Valid Texas Department of Education license with Special Education and Core/Generalist endorsements
  • Demonstrated experience as a Special Education Teacher, preferably in foundational/life skills settings
  • Comfortable and capable in ARD meetings, contributing insights and advocating for students
  • Commitment to professional appearance: single color hair, professional attire, no visible tattoos, and limited earrings as per school policy

Primary Responsibilities:

  • Deliver individualized life skills and foundational academic instruction to EC-6 students
  • Develop and implement Individualized Education Plans (IEPs) in alignment with student needs
  • Foster positive, inclusive classroom environments
  • Collaborate with other educators, therapists, and families to support student growth
  • Attend and actively contribute to ARD meetings, advocating for student needs
